Janus-Pro-7B入门必看:图像问答+文生图双路径并行机制详解

张开发
2026/4/18 14:49:52 15 分钟阅读

分享文章

Janus-Pro-7B入门必看:图像问答+文生图双路径并行机制详解
Janus-Pro-7B入门必看图像问答文生图双路径并行机制详解1. 模型概述统一多模态理解与生成Janus-Pro-7B是DeepSeek推出的突破性多模态模型它解决了传统模型在处理不同任务时出现的性能冲突问题。传统模型往往在图像理解任务上表现优秀时图像生成能力就会受限反之亦然。Janus-Pro-7B通过创新的双路径并行架构成功实现了理解与生成能力的平衡。这个模型的核心价值在于它的统一性。你不需要为不同任务部署多个专用模型一个Janus-Pro-7B就能处理图像问答、OCR识别、图表分析、文生图、图生文等多种任务。这种统一性不仅降低了部署复杂度还提高了实际应用效率。模型训练使用了9000万条高质量数据涵盖了各种视觉-语言任务场景。通过优化的训练策略Janus-Pro-7B在保持强大能力的同时确保了生成的稳定性和可靠性。2. 技术突破双路径并行架构解析2.1 视觉编码器解耦设计Janus-Pro-7B最核心的创新是解耦的视觉编码架构。传统模型使用单一的视觉编码器处理所有任务这就像让一个专家同时做多项专业工作难免顾此失彼。Janus-Pro-7B采用双路径设计理解路径专门处理图像问答、OCR、图表分析等理解性任务重点保证语义准确性生成路径专注于文生图、图生文等创造性任务注重像素级细节还原这种设计让每个路径都能优化自己的专长避免了任务间的相互干扰。理解路径可以专注于提取准确的语义信息而生成路径则可以专注于创造高质量的视觉内容。2.2 并行处理机制双路径并不是完全独立的它们通过精心设计的交互机制实现协同工作。当处理复杂任务时比如需要先理解图像内容再生成相关描述两个路径可以并行处理并交换信息。这种并行机制的优势很明显处理速度更快不需要串行执行多个步骤信息损失更少避免了多次转换中的信息衰减结果更准确理解与生成过程可以相互校正3. 快速上手Web界面使用指南3.1 环境访问与准备使用Janus-Pro-7B非常简单通过Web界面就能完成所有操作。首先确保服务已经正常启动然后在浏览器中输入访问地址http://你的服务器IP:7860如果是本地部署可以直接访问http://localhost:7860首次访问时模型可能需要1-2分钟的加载时间这是正常现象。加载完成后你会看到清晰的功能分区界面。3.2 界面功能分区Web界面分为两个主要功能区左侧是多模态理解区域用于图像问答和相关分析任务。你可以在这里上传图片向模型提问获取对图像内容的深度理解。右侧是文本生成图像区域用于创意图像生成。输入文字描述模型就会生成对应的视觉内容每次生成5张图片供你选择。4. 图像问答功能详解4.1 支持的任务类型Janus-Pro-7B的图像问答能力覆盖了大多数实际需求场景内容描述类让模型描述图片中的场景、物体、人物等。比如上传一张风景照问描述这张图片中的场景。物体识别类识别图片中的特定物体或元素。例如图片中有几只猫、找出所有的汽车。图表分析类解析图表、曲线图、表格中的数据。可以问这个图表显示了什么趋势、第三列的数据总和是多少。文字识别类提取图片中的文字内容包括印刷体和手写体。特别适合处理文档图片、海报、标志等。推理分析类基于图片内容进行逻辑推理。比如根据这个表情包推测使用场景、分析这张照片的拍摄时间。4.2 优化问答效果的技巧要获得更好的问答效果可以注意以下几点提问要具体不要问这张图片怎么样而是问描述图片中的主要物体和场景。提供上下文如果问题涉及特定领域可以在问题中稍作说明。比如从医学角度分析这张X光片。分步提问复杂问题可以拆分成多个简单问题。先问图片中有哪些物体再针对特定物体深入提问。调整参数根据问题类型调整温度参数。事实性问题用低温0.1-0.3创意性问题用高温0.5-0.8。5. 文本生成图像功能详解5.1 提示词编写技巧文生图的效果很大程度上取决于提示词的质量。以下是一些实用技巧具体描述不要只说一只猫而是描述一只橘色的短毛猫绿色眼睛坐在窗台上阳光照射.指定风格明确想要的艺术风格如水彩画风格、照片级真实、皮克斯动画风格.添加质量词使用8k分辨率、高度细节、电影感光效等词汇提升输出质量。组合元素合理组合主体、环境、风格等元素。例如宇航员在热带雨林中冷色调细节丰富.5.2 参数调整策略不同的参数设置会产生截然不同的效果CFG权重控制模型对提示词的遵循程度。值越高越严格遵循提示词但过高可能导致图像过于僵硬。简单提示词用5-7复杂提示词用3-5。温度参数影响生成多样性。值越高结果越多样化但可能偏离预期。建议范围0.8-1.0。随机种子固定种子可以重现相同的结果改变种子则会产生新的变体。适合批量生成时保持一致性。6. 实际应用案例展示6.1 教育场景应用在教育领域Janus-Pro-7B可以发挥重要作用。教师可以上传历史图片让学生通过问答了解历史事件上传数学公式图片让学生学习LaTeX编码上传科学图表训练学生的数据分析能力。比如上传一张物理实验装置图问这个实验装置用于验证什么物理定律、列出图中所有测量仪器。模型不仅能识别物体还能解释其科学用途。6.2 创意设计应用对于创意工作者文生图功能是强大的灵感工具。设计师可以输入概念描述快速生成视觉草图文案人员可以生成配图灵感营销人员可以创建广告视觉方案。例如输入未来城市夜景赛博朋克风格霓虹灯闪烁飞行汽车就能得到一系列创意概念图为项目提供视觉参考。6.3 内容分析应用媒体和内容创作者可以用图像问答功能分析视觉内容。上传新闻图片分析其中的关键元素上传社交媒体图片理解视觉传播趋势上传产品图片进行竞品分析。这种分析不仅限于表面内容还能挖掘深层信息比如图像的情感倾向、文化符号含义、视觉构图特点等。7. 性能优化与问题解决7.1 硬件配置建议为了获得最佳性能建议的硬件配置GPU至少RTX 309024GB显存推荐RTX 409024GB显存。模型需要约14-15GB显存。内存建议32GB以上系统内存确保流畅运行。存储50GB以上SSD空间保证快速加载和缓存。7.2 常见问题处理生成速度慢这是正常现象文生图需要30-60秒因为模型需要生成576个图像token并通过解码器转换为图像。图片质量不理想尝试优化提示词添加更多细节描述调整CFG权重和温度参数。服务无响应检查GPU内存是否充足查看服务日志排查问题。可以通过命令supervisorctl status janus-pro检查服务状态。显存不足如果出现显存错误可以尝试重启服务释放内存supervisorctl restart janus-pro。8. 总结与进阶建议Janus-Pro-7B通过创新的双路径并行架构成功解决了多模态模型中理解与生成任务的冲突问题。这种设计不仅提升了单项任务的性能更重要的是实现了真正的多模态统一处理。对于初学者建议从简单的问答和文生图开始逐步熟悉模型的特性和参数调节。多尝试不同的提示词和参数组合积累使用经验。对于进阶用户可以探索更复杂的应用场景比如多轮对话中的图像理解、跨模态的内容创作、批量处理自动化等。模型支持API调用可以集成到各种应用中。记住好的结果往往需要多次迭代优化。不要期望一次就得到完美结果而是通过不断调整提示词和参数逐步逼近理想效果。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。

更多文章